💬 Nutrition Q&A: Sweet Peach Bbq Sauce

Is Sweet Peach Bbq Sauce good for weight loss?

This sauce is quite calorie-dense for its serving size, with over half its calories coming from sugar. While a small amount as a condiment won't derail weight loss, it's easy to use more than a single 29g serving, which would quickly add up.

How might Sweet Peach Bbq Sauce affect blood sugar?

With 16g of sugar and minimal fiber or protein to slow digestion, this sauce will cause a fairly rapid blood sugar spike. It's not ideal for managing blood sugar, though using it sparingly as a glaze rather than a dipping sauce can help limit the impact.

Is Sweet Peach Bbq Sauce gluten-free?

The Worcestershire sauce in the ingredient list contains anchovies and other components that are typically gluten-free, but Worcestershire sauce formulations vary by brand. You'd need to verify the specific Worcestershire sauce used here, as some contain gluten.

What diets does Sweet Peach Bbq Sauce suit?

This sauce doesn't align well with low-sugar, keto, or diabetic-friendly diets given its high sugar content. It could work in moderation for paleo diets if the specific Worcestershire sauce is compliant, but the added sugars make it a better occasional condiment than a dietary staple.

What should I watch out for with Sweet Peach Bbq Sauce?

The sugar content is the main concern—16g per serving is substantial, nearly a third of a typical daily limit. Sodium is also moderately high at 300mg per serving, so account for that if you're watching your intake.
